Travelers Resthome

made by Seppä Erkki, aka BlackSmith, heureka 2003/12/03, updated 2004/07/12

This is a 4” high, 2” wide and only ½” thin small door frame that has a tiny door witch leads to extradimensional dwelling that is similar to the spell Mordekein's Magnificen't Mansion.
When placed on the ground and if enough space (otherwise it shrinks back), it grows in one full round to an as high as 8 feet, 4 feet wide and ½ feet thick door that has a frame that is completely made from mithril. The door itself can be made of variable materials.
This main door is water and air tight and can be only, and only, opened by the person who placed it on the ground but anyone can step trough it and also close it or open it from inside. If the door is closed without anyone inside the Rest Home, it shrinks back to its miniature form.

Inside the door there are 20 servants who act as unseen servants, waiting at the great hall ready to serve at the best of their abilities. Except the servants are vaguely transparent making them visible to everyone and can’t leave the complex, they try serve their best to anyone inside of the complex.

Also there are 24 other rooms that are linked to the great hall with variable purposes noted below All of them can be lighted or dimmed simply by asking it while in the room. All of the rooms are also equipped with a fireplace usually inlaid in to the wall opposite to the door. If a fire is kept in these fireplaces, the smoke is magically transferred out so it looks like it rises between the frame and main door; any smoke hitting the sealing of the complex is also moved out in the same manner. Every door in the complex is made (magically copied) from the same material as the main door and all of them block sound completely except regular knocking that can be heard trough them without problem. Also any sound generated in 5ft from the door is also audible 5ft at the other side of the door. For after one full day (24h) after the complex is grown it does not generate any fresh air and its fires go out resulting to it’s temperature rapidly moving towards the outer temperature. Arrogant or ignorant inhabitants might suffocate or freeze to death after long enough time if the main door isnīt opened to gain fresh air or if no heat is generated by other means or if the complex is not refreshed as noted below.

Casting Mordekein's Magnificent Mansion inside of the Rest Home refreshes it, thus all it’s worn out functions are available again. Also after it has been 8 hours in its shrunken form it refreshes. Taking extradimensional items (e.g. Bag of Holding) inside the complex is safe but opening them or opening new extradimensional pockets results for its entire contest to be spilled out from the main door simultaneous destroying the container, or in case of spell negating the whole spell, but in any case this also refreshes the Rest Home. However, dimensional travel is not affected in any way.

Any items left behind in Resthome stay there but only 1/50 part of their weight is added to its shrunk form. Note that in shrunken form it can not be opened by any means, breaking the door in its miniature form only result for its entire contest to be scattered around astral plane and the door frame turning into simple mithril door frame with its magic gone. Also note that the frame will not shrink without a door.
Door materials Hardness Hp's Break DC Weight Cost
Sturdy wooden 5 20 23 4 lb 40gp
Blackwood 5 20 23 2 lb 80gp
Stone 8 30 25 20 lb 500 gp
Iron 10 60 28 25 lb 2,500 gp
Mithral 15 60 32 12,5 lb 6,500 gp
Admantine 20 80 38 25 lb 10,800 gp
Wall of Force Indestructible but transparent,
as Wall of Force
Weightless Cost for casting Wall of Force,
followed with Wish
Caster level: 13th
Prerequisites: Craft Wondrous Items; Cure Minor Wounds, Heat Metal, Mordekein's Magnificent Mansion, Shrink Item.
Market Price: 43,360gp + the doors price
Weight: Frame weights 1lb + the doors weight + 1/50 weight of the items left inside.
